Question
Find the value of `θ(0^circ < θ < 90^circ)` if :
`tan35^circ cot(90^circ - θ) = 1`
Advertisements
Solution
`tan35^circ cot(90^circ - θ) = 1`
Given `tan35^circ cot(90^circ - θ) = 1`
⇒ `tan35^circtanθ = 1`
⇒ `tan35^circ = cotθ`
⇒ `tan35^circ = tan(90^circ - θ)`
⇒ `90^circ - θ = 35^circ`
⇒ `θ = 55^circ`
